What is a UV operator?

A UV Operator is responsible for operating and maintaining UV printing machines, which use ultraviolet light to cure inks and coatings on various materials. Their duties include setting up the printer, adjusting settings for different materials, performing routine maintenance, and ensuring print quality. They work with design files, troubleshoot technical issues, and follow safety guidelines to ensure efficient production. UV Operators are commonly employed in industries such as packaging, signage, and commercial printing. Strong attention to detail and knowledge of printing processes are essential for this role.

The Press You’ll Master

You will be commanding our 40-inch, 5-color LED-UV Komori Lithrone sheetfed press. This powerhouse is fully equipped for fast, efficient, dry-to-touch production.

Komori Equipment Features:

  • Instant LED-UV Curing & Inline AQ Coater: Next-level finishing technology.
  • KHS-AI (Komori Hyper System with AI): A brilliant self-learning ink presetting and register system that slashes makeready waste to a fraction of traditional presses.
  • Auto Plate Changing: Keeping setups fast and seamless.
  • Automatic Wash-Up: Automated cleaning for ink rollers, blanket cylinders, and impression cylinders.
